    Canned sorrel, 275g

    The taste of canned sorrel is sour and salty. This is due to the fact that due to the high concentration of malic acid, sorrel has a recognizable pronounced sour taste. You can use canned sorrel to prepare the first courses (cabbage soup, borscht, cold brew, okroshka). It is also added to vegetable dishes (stewed, boiled), potatoes, especially in the form of mashed potatoes, which gets a beautiful color and a peculiar sourness. Another option is to use sorrel for baking (pies, pies). In addition, you can prepare desserts (such as ice cream) and refreshing cocktails with these herbs. Canned sorrel vegetables can also be consumed as an independent dish. Ingredients: Sorrel 95%, water, table salt. Country of origin: Poland

  • Borscht with Sauerkraut, 500g.

    Borscht with Sauerkraut, 500g

    Pickled borscht with a slight sourness. Borscht made from fresh cabbage is more popular in summer, and borscht made from sauerkraut is more suitable in winter. It is more saturated and dense. Borscht is served hot with fresh herbs and sour cream. Ingredients: Beetroot (60%), potatoes (19%), sauerkraut (12%), onions (7%), carrots (6%), tomato paste, vegetable oil, spices, salt. Countrty of origin: Germany
